Transaction 8d1756166eb0b081708bb1686f94677cbf76f044bb32a9b992f3dbde59bd463f

1 Input
2 Outputs
  • 8d1756166eb0b081708bb1686f94677cbf76f044bb32a9b992f3dbde59bd463f:0
  • value  99850000
    address  38sm7xd5ntuLCZc3dofEYiJYFP8YhxqruA
  • 8d1756166eb0b081708bb1686f94677cbf76f044bb32a9b992f3dbde59bd463f:1
  • value  1223802707
    address  3DpTk3gcVicmV1zL7hME6AwHXSqsywHdub